This Considerable Overview Serves As Your Trick To Unlocking The Secrets Of Internet Services And Coming To Be A Master In The Field
This Considerable Overview Serves As Your Trick To Unlocking The Secrets Of Internet Services And Coming To Be A Master In The Field
Blog Article
Composed By-Schou Troelsen
Discover the utmost Web Solutions Handbook for all your requirements. Check out communication methods, core ideas of SOAP and remainder, and finest practices for smooth application. Discover the tricks to grasping web services, from comprehending the fundamentals to implementing scalable style. Master the art of creating protected systems and enhancing for future growth. Unlock the power of web services at your fingertips.
Summary of Web Solutions
If you've ever before wondered what internet solutions are and just how they function, this review is the excellent place to begin. Web services are a means for different applications to connect with each other online. They permit seamless integration of systems, making it less complicated to share information and functionalities.
One of the vital elements of web solutions is their use conventional methods like HTTP and XML to facilitate communication. This standardization guarantees that different systems can understand and communicate with each other efficiently. Internet solutions can be classified into two main types: SOAP (Simple Things Gain Access To Method) and REST (Representational State Transfer).
https://www.fool.com/the-ascent/small-business/email-marketing/articles/marketing-101/ is a procedure that makes use of XML for message exchange, while remainder counts on standard HTTP methods like GET, POST, PUT, and remove. Both have their staminas and are made use of in different scenarios based on requirements.
Key Ideas and Technologies
Exploring the fundamental concepts and modern technologies of internet solutions is essential for comprehending their capability and application in contemporary systems. When delving right into the essential principles and modern technologies of web services, you unlock to a globe of interconnected possibilities. Right here are some essential elements to realize:
- ** SOAP (Simple Item Gain Access To Protocol) **: This method specifies the framework of messages traded between web services.
- ** WSDL (Web Solutions Description Language) **: WSDL is utilized to define the functionalities offered by a web service.
- ** REMAINDER (Representational State Transfer) **: An architectural style that makes use of standard HTTP approaches for communication between clients and servers.
- ** XML (Extensible Markup Language) **: XML plays a critical role in data exchange between internet services due to its versatility and readability.
Comprehending these core concepts and modern technologies will certainly lay a solid structure for your journey into the realm of internet services.
Best Practices for Application
To guarantee successful implementation of internet services, focus on adherence to best practices. Begin by thoroughly recording your web solution APIs, including clear descriptions of endpoints, criteria, and expected reactions. Consistent calling conventions and versioning of APIs are crucial for maintainability. When developing your web services, adhere to the principles of REST to create a scalable and versatile design. Execute appropriate verification and permission mechanisms to secure your solutions, such as OAuth or API secrets.
Checking is essential in ensuring the reliability of your web services. Create detailed test cases that cover numerous situations, including positive and negative testing. Continual integration and automated testing can aid capture issues early in the growth procedure. Screen your web solutions in real-time to determine performance bottlenecks and prospective failings. Logging and mistake handling are essential for diagnosing concerns and repairing troubles properly.
Last but not least, take into consideration the scalability of your web solutions deliberately for future development. Execute caching systems and lots harmonizing to take care of increased web traffic. seo made simple and optimize your code for effectiveness. By complying with these ideal techniques, you can simplify the application of internet services and guarantee their success.
Conclusion
Congratulations! You have actually simply unlocked the key to mastering web services. By understanding the key principles and innovations, and implementing ideal methods, you're well on your means to becoming a web services expert.
Maintain checking out and try out what best managed hosting have actually discovered to continue broadening your understanding and abilities in this amazing area.
The world of internet solutions is currently at your fingertips, prepared for you to check out and dominate. Take pleasure in the journey!